Weight Loss therapists in Mountain Meadows, CO Statistics

Weight Loss therapists in Mountain Meadows, CO average 14 years of experience and charge around $223 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(63%), Behavioral Therapy (50%), and Solution-Focused Brief Therapy (SFBT) (46%).
